Valentin Zukovsky
A Russian gangster with a past in the KGB.
Valentin Dmitrovich Zukovsky is a Russian gangster and ex-KGB officer who appears in the 1995 James Bond film GoldenEye. He is portrayed by Robbie Coltrane.
